...This is an ok amp. Nothing more, nothing less. It plays neutral with a coloring a bit towards the warm side (typical Marantz). It is has all the features needed for an amp today (Thumbs up for the 'Source Direct' switch!), looks good and is easy to use. The problem with this amp is, unfortunately, it's ability to present music. Even though it has no "screaming" weaknesses, it has no apparent strengths neither. It becomes a bit boring too me. Midrange is the weakest side of this amp. When given songs where theres a lot going on in the midrange (Soilwork - Follow The Hollow, Pink FLoyd - The Dark Side of The Moon), it gets messy. It also lacks the open "top" to give Tool - Vicarious or Dire Straits -The Man's Too Strong the snappy sound it deserves. Also the bottom tends to get a bit "wool-like". ...Introduction................................. I owned a Marantz PM66se until fairly recently, upgrading to a much more powerful NAD c370. Whilst the NAD is obviously more powerful, it lacks some of the subtly and musicality of the Marantz amp. The Marantz has all the features most people will ever need, and you can now pick one up for a bargain price. IT even looks good (in my opinion - although I am a fan of the 'Marantz look').
